The Opportunity

Within the role, you will be a key part of the UK IT team supporting a growing business. We have key legacy systems needing migration and requests to implement new processes to improve efficiency and productivity. The business is also hungry for business intelligence. Whilst you won’t be doing this on your own you will be helping the team to manage these projects to completion.

This is an excellent time to join KB IT as we will be going through a transformational time with the move to Cloud applications and SaaS. In addition to the projects there will be a day job and that will consist of the general IT support ranging from walking the floor and building laptops through to VMware Administration and Cisco switch administration. This is a great opportunity to visit all areas of the business and to get an understanding of what they do. Meeting colleagues you wouldn’t normally meet.

About Knorr-Bremse

In the early 1800s, British engineer Richard Trevithick (1771-1833) constructed the first railway steam locomotive that travelled at 8 kilometres per hour. Today in Asia trains travel at maximum speeds of up to 260 kilometers per hour. By 1850 Britain had more than 6,000 miles of railroad track, today in the UK there are 20,277 miles (32,186 kilometres) of track.

More than a billion people worldwide rely daily on Knorr-Bremse systems. Knorr-Bremse is the world’s leading manufacturer of braking systems for rail and commercial vehicles. As a technology pioneer, for over 100 years Knorr-Bremse has been a driving force in the development, production and sale of modern braking systems for a variety of applications in the area of rail and commercial vehicles.
